#04390D Color
#04390D is rgb(4, 57, 13) in RGB, hsl(130, 87%, 12%) in HSL, and about cmyk(93%, 0%, 77%, 78%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Forest Green (Traditional) (#014421),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.74.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#04390D Channel Values
How #04390D bre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 4 · G 57 · B 13 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 130° · S 87% · L 12%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 130° · S 93% · V 22%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 93% · M 0% · Y 77% · K 78%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 13.16:1 vs white · 1.6: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#04390D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#04390D?
#04390D is a darkest green — rgb(4, 57, 13) in RGB and hsl(130, 87%, 12%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Forest Green (Traditional) (#014421),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.74.
What is the RGB value of #04390D?
#04390D is rgb(4, 57, 13) — red 4, green 57, and blue 13 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#04390D?
#04390D converts to approximately cmyk(93%, 0%, 77%, 78%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#04390D be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#04390D scores 13.16:1 against white and 1.6: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#04390D as a CSS color keyword?
No. #04390D is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kolivegreen (#556B2F) at a CIE76 distance of 25.65, which is a different colour altogether.
